The Cabrillo College Children's Center & Lab School is a campus-based early care and education program and laboratory school serving infants, toddlers and preschool children and providing related training and observation opportunities.
The Children's Center & Lab School is a campus-based early care and education program affiliated with Cabrillo College that serves young children from infancy through entry to kindergarten. The program describes itself as a laboratory school that supports child development and early childhood workforce training.
The center emphasizes developmentally appropriate early care and education, inclusion and diversity, and a collaborative culture. It operates as a laboratory school to provide hands-on training and mentoring for Early Childhood Education (ECE) students and to support related academic observation and research.
No- or low-cost subsidized child care services offered to student parents to support their academic and career education goals.
Non-intrusive observation opportunities for visitors and students from surrounding colleges studying child development and related fields.
Hands-on, laboratory-school based workforce development training and mentoring for ECE students.
A developmentally appropriate early care and education program intended to support children's social-emotional, cognitive and physical development.
